The name Punny is a modern, affectionate name derived from the English word 'pun,' meaning a witty play on words. It reflects a playful and clever personality, often associated with humor and lightheartedness. Although not historically common as a given name, Punny embodies the joy of wordplay and creativity in language.
While 'Punny' is a contemporary and uncommon name, it captures the cultural appreciation for wit and humor that has been valued in English-speaking societies for centuries. Pun-based humor has roots in classical literature, and naming a child Punny might symbolize a family's embrace of intelligence, joy, and linguistic creativity. Its emerging use reflects modern trends towards quirky and meaningful names.
